Why does my compressor suddenly stop while running?
The compressor suddenly stopping can be caused by overheating, electrical issues, low oil levels, or excessive pressure. Check for these issues and contact technical service if necessary.
Why is my compressor not producing air pressure?
The lack of air pressure production may be due to a faulty pressure switch, clogged valves, or worn piston rings. Inspect all connections and components.
Is it normal for water to come from my compressor?
Yes, compressors condense moisture from the air. It is important to regularly open the drain valve to discharge the accumulated water.
Is it a problem if my compressor is making excessive noise?
Yes, excessive noise from compressors may indicate a problem with the valves, bearings, or motor components. Immediate maintenance is required.
How often should the compressor filter be replaced?
Depending on operating conditions, air filters should typically be replaced every 6 months or more frequently if operating in a dirty environment.
How can I check the oil level of the compressor?
You can check the oil level using the oil gauge or dipstick on the compressor. The oil level should be between the minimum and maximum marks.
Why does the compressor motor overheat?
Overheating can be caused by inadequate ventilation, high ambient temperature, using the wrong oil, or overloading.
How is the compressor air tank cleaned?
To clean the compressor air tank, open the drain valve to discharge accumulated moisture and dirt. Performing this regularly helps prevent corrosion.
Why does my compressor frequently cycle on and off?
This issue may be caused by incorrect pressure switch settings, an air leak, or a malfunction in the pressure regulator. Check the settings and fix any leaks.
How is an air leak detected in a compressor?
You can apply soapy water to the area with a potential air leak and observe if bubbles form. If bubbles appear, there is an air leak in that area.
Why am I experiencing frequent hose bursts in the compressor?
Hose bursts can be caused by excessive pressure, using the wrong size hose, or the hose becoming worn out. Check the appropriate pressure settings and use high-quality hoses.
What should I do if the compressor is not working?
Check the electrical connections, fuses, thermal relay, and power supply. If the issue persists, contact technical service.
What happens if the compressor runs without oil?
Running without oil causes excessive friction in the motor and pistons, leading to damage. This can result in serious failures and costly repairs.
Is there a risk of the compressor tank exploding?
There is a risk of explosion in tanks that are not regularly maintained and where the release of pressurized air is neglected. Therefore, it is important to periodically inspect the tank.
How is the compressor air outlet pressure adjusted?
You can adjust the air outlet pressure to the desired level using the pressure regulator on the compressor.
How often should I change the compressor oil?
The compressor oil should generally be changed every 3 to 6 months, depending on operating conditions. Regular oil changes enhance the compressor's performance and extend its lifespan.
What happens if the compressor filter is clogged?
A clogged filter reduces the compressor's efficiency and can cause the motor to overheat. The filter needs to be regularly cleaned or replaced.
How is the compressor cooled?
The compressor cooling system can be either air cooling or water cooling. Additionally, ensure that the area where the compressor operates is well-ventilated, taking the ambient temperature into account.
Why is the compressor consuming excessive oil?
Excessive oil consumption can be caused by worn piston rings, sealing issues, or incorrect oil usage. Check the oil level and sealing condition.
What should I pay attention to for the efficient operation of the compressor?
Regular maintenance, cleaning of filters, correct pressure settings, and checking the oil level ensure the efficient operation of the compressor.
How can I prevent air leaks in the compressor?
Regularly check all connection points and tighten hoses, valves, or seals. Regular maintenance helps prevent leaks.
How often should I perform compressor maintenance?
The maintenance intervals for compressors vary depending on the usage intensity, but generally, maintenance is recommended every 6 months or annually.
Is it normal for my compressor to emit a smell?
If there is a burning smell coming from the compressor, the motor may be overheating. This could be a sign of a serious electrical issue and should be inspected immediately.
How should compressor valve maintenance be performed?
The valves should be regularly cleaned and checked for proper operation. Faulty valves should be replaced immediately.
Why is a compressor air dryer important?
The air dryer removes moisture from the compressed air system and prevents equipment from rusting. This extends the compressor's lifespan and increases its efficiency.
Why is my compressor constantly leaking oil?
Oil leaks are typically caused by worn seals or loose connections. Check these components and make any necessary replacements.
What causes wear on the compressor connection parts?
Excessive pressure, improper installation, or the use of weak materials can lead to wear. Using high-quality parts can help prevent this issue.
My compressor is not drawing air, what could be the cause?
Filter blockage, valve failure, or piston issues could cause the compressor not to draw air. Inspect these components and clean or replace them as needed.
Why does the compressor's automatic shutdown system activate?
Overheating, excessive pressure, or electrical issues can cause the compressor to automatically shut down for protection. Identify the cause and resolve the issue.
What are common mistakes made during compressor maintenance?
Common mistakes include not regularly checking the oil level, failing to replace filters on time, and neglecting to ensure the tightness of connection points.
Why is the pressure increasing very slowly while the compressor is running?
Slow pressure increase may be caused by clogged air filters, piston wear, or issues with the valves. Clean the filters and check the pistons.
The compressor's cooling system is not functioning properly, what should I do?
Insufficient cooling in the system may be caused by dirty air ducts, a faulty fan, or low oil levels. Clean the ducts, check the fan, and review the oil level.
Is it normal for the compressor to keep shutting down while operating?
If the compressor keeps shutting down, there may be an issue with the pressure switch, thermal protection, or overload. Check the pressure switch and protect the motor from overload.
The compressor tank is leaking air, how can I repair it?
Detect the air leak by using soapy water and tighten the connection where the leak is found. If there is a crack in the tank, seek professional assistance.
Why is the compressor producing excessive vibrations while running?
Excessive vibrations can be caused by loose mounting parts, an uneven surface, or bearing issues. Tighten the mounting parts and ensure the compressor is on a level surface.
There is a blockage in the compressor hose, is this a problem?
Yes, a blockage in the hose restricts airflow and reduces the compressor's efficiency. Check the hose and clear the blockage.
Why is the compressor motor running slowly?
Slow operation could be caused by electrical issues, motor overheating, or low voltage. Check the electrical connections and inspect the motor's cooling system.
How can gas leaks in a compressor be detected?
Apply soapy water to areas suspected of having gas leaks. If bubbles form, there is a leak at that point. Tighten or repair the leaking connection.
Why does the fuse blow when the compressor runs?
The fuse blowing could be caused by a short circuit, overload, or motor failure. Check the electrical circuit and seek assistance from an electrician if necessary.
Why does the compressor's thermal protection switch keep activating?
Overheating, low oil levels, or a dirty cooling system can cause the thermal protection switch to activate. Check the oil level and clean the cooling system.
Why is the compressor pressure suddenly dropping?
Sudden pressure drops can be caused by air leaks, a faulty pressure valve, or issues with the tank. Check the valves and fix any leaks.
How can the compressor's performance be improved?
To improve compressor performance, perform regular maintenance, clean the filters, use the correct oil, and prevent air leaks. Additionally, ensure the compressor operates in suitable environmental conditions.
Why is the compressor consuming more energy than necessary?
Excessive energy consumption can be caused by dirty filters, leaks, or incorrect pressure settings. Clean the filters and optimize the pressure settings.
Why is the quality of the oil used in the compressor important?
High-quality oil reduces friction and prevents wear on components. Low-quality oil can shorten the compressor's lifespan and lead to failures.
Is oil leaking from the compressor connections, is this normal?
Oil leakage at connection points is not normal. Check the seals and connection points, tighten them if loose, and replace the sealing components if necessary.
How can the compressor be protected from voltage fluctuations?
You can protect the compressor from voltage fluctuations by using a voltage regulator or stabilizer. This helps prevent damage to the motor.
Why is the compressor not shutting down automatically?
The automatic shutdown system may not be working due to a faulty pressure switch or thermal protection. Check these components and replace them if necessary.
How often should the compressor tank be cleaned?
The compressor tank should be cleaned every 3 to 6 months to drain condensed moisture and dirt. Regular cleaning extends the tank's lifespan and prevents rusting.
Why is the compressor air pressure not staying at the set level?
The pressure not stabilizing can be caused by a faulty pressure switch, air leaks, or regulator issues. Check the pressure switch and regulator.
Why is the compressor starting slowly or not turning on?
Slow starting or failure to start can be caused by weak electrical connections, motor overload, or a faulty pressure switch. Check the electrical circuit and test the pressure switch.
How can I tell if the compressor oil filter is clogged?
If the oil filter is clogged, the compressor motor will have to work harder and may overheat. A pressure drop may also be observed. Check the filter for blockages and replace it if necessary.
How can I reduce vibration levels while the compressor is running?
To reduce vibration levels, place the compressor on a stable surface, tighten the mounting connections, and use rubber feet or vibration-damping pads.
Why does the compressor struggle to operate in low temperatures?
At low temperatures, compressor oil thickens, making it harder for the motor to operate. Use oil suitable for low temperatures during the winter months and allow the compressor to warm up before starting it.
Why do compressor valves frequently clog?
Frequent valve blockages can be caused by dirty air, moisture, or improper lubrication. Perform regular maintenance to clean the valves and check the air filters frequently.
